Beautiful 4k panel with stunning clarity. The smartTV features are also great, but not quite as easy to use as Samsung's. The only drawback of this panel is LG's strange decision to use an adapter for Composite and Component AV inputs. Instead of having the regular inputs, they require the use of a 3.5mm adapter. Trying to feed audio and video through a 3.5mm jack? Strange, I know.
Unfortunately the panel I bought had an issue with the Composite input (old DirectTV box). Whenever the video (yellow cord) was plugged into the adapter I would get no video and just a loud buzz. Geeksquad swapped out the main board, which didn't help. Then they sent a new adapter, but that didn't work either.
I ended up exchanging for a Samsung 7150. It's not 4k, but you can barely tell the difference. Samsung is the clear leader for me. Sorry LG, you're a distant second.
If you solely used HDMI inputs on this panel, then I'd suggest it.
